Dmitry Patroshev, the Russian minister of agriculture, announced today, on Saturday, that his nation is prepared to give the world’s poorest nations a free grain donation of up to 500,000 tonnes over the course of the next four months.
Given that Russia has consistently been and continues to be a trustworthy and ready partner in supplying the globe with the appropriate amount of food, our nation is prepared to give the poorest nations up to 500 thousand tonnes of grains for free over the course of the next four months.

“By returning to the results of the grain deal, it is worth noting that within a period of more than three months of its work, about 500 thousand tons of grains were shipped to truly poor and struggling countries, according to our estimates. ”
The minister emphasised that these nations paid for their own grain purchases from Ukraine.
